Raise the declared minimums in pubspec.yaml to what our deps already
require: Flutter >=3.35.0 / Dart >=3.9.0 (was 3.19.0 / 3.5.0). alchemist
0.12 needs Flutter 3.32; Dart 3.9 first ships in Flutter 3.35, so 3.35 is
the binding floor. Pin the exact build toolchain in .fvmrc (Flutter
3.44.1).
Moving to the Dart 3.9 language level switches `dart format` to the new
"tall" style and enables two new lints. This commit is the resulting
mechanical churn, isolated from any behaviour change:
- whole-tree `dart format` reformat (tall style)
- `dart fix` for unnecessary_underscores + use_null_aware_elements
No runtime behaviour change; `make test` green.

Nine surfaces hand-rolled the same anchored-overlay + row-list + barrier +
keyboard-nav pattern. Extract one owned primitive (no Material):
- ClideAnchoredOverlay (clide_anchored.dart): positioning + lifecycle —
LayerLink/CompositedTransformFollower or centred Positioned, side/align +
auto-flip on viewport bounds, full-screen tap-away barrier, OverlayEntry
bookkeeping, focus capture, Esc-to-close. Driven by a ClideOverlayController.
- ClideMenu + ClideMenuListController (clide_menu.dart): a dropdown-token row
surface (items + separators) with arrow/enter/escape nav, skip-disabled,
active mark, per-item colour/leading glyph, keepOpenOnSelect (live-apply),
and onArrowLeft/Right hooks. The nav controller is reusable by surfaces that
keep bespoke rows (typeaheads, quick-open).
Additive — no call sites changed yet. D-88 records the convention (new `design`
domain): anchored pickers build on these; modal pickers stay on DialogRouter.
Tests: clide_anchored_test (open/close, barrier, Esc, centred, clean dispose)
and clide_menu_test (list-nav skip/wrap, select + onClose, disabled, Esc,
keepOpenOnSelect; pure ClideMenuListController cases).
